Transaction 6bf207d12306c86fe59bb9a59108e53c3d84f6c2da163a36f990742cdf1f9914
1 Input
1 Output
-
6bf207d12306c86fe59bb9a59108e53c3d84f6c2da163a36f990742cdf1f9914:0
- value
- 500627
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4a66edcd5958a5e56b5db26527f02f52157686c OP_EQUAL
- address
- 3JACw3Ys3esbeE4zydCzJDN2SWzawc3vSW